Analysis of Multiple Overlapping Paths algorithms for Secure Key Exchange in Large-Scale Quantum Networks. (arXiv:2205.03174v1 [quant-ph])
May 9, 2022, 1:20 a.m. | Mateusz Stępniak, Jakub Mielczarek
cs.CR updates on arXiv.org arxiv.org
Quantum networks open the way to an unprecedented level of communication
security. However, due to physical limitations on the distances of quantum
links, current implementations of quantum networks are unavoidably equipped
with trusted nodes. As a consequence, the quantum key distribution can be
performed only on the links. Due to this, some new authentication and key
exchange schemes must be considered to fully benefit from the unconditional
security of links. One such approach uses Multiple Non-Overlapping Paths
